Kforce (KFRC) Expected to Announce Earnings on Monday

Kforce logo with Business Services background

Kforce (NASDAQ:KFRC - Get Free Report) is expected to be releasing its earnings data after the market closes on Monday, April 28th. Analysts expect Kforce to post earnings of $0.48 per share and revenue of $334.61 million for the quarter.

Kforce Stock Performance

Shares of KFRC stock traded down $0.08 during trading hours on Friday, hitting $43.96. The stock had a trading volume of 134,247 shares, compared to its average volume of 120,918. The stock's 50 day moving average is $47.88 and its 200 day moving average is $53.73. Kforce has a twelve month low of $42.11 and a twelve month high of $71.48. The firm has a market capitalization of $840.10 million, a PE ratio of 16.40 and a beta of 0.76.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16, a current ratio of 2.06 and a quick ratio of 2.06.

Kforce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, March 21st.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 7th were issued a $0.39 dividend. This represents a $1.56 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.55%. This is a boost from Kforce's previous quarterly dividend of $0.38.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, March 7th. Kforce's dividend payout ratio is presently 58.21%.

About Kforce

(Get Free Report)

Kforce Inc provides professional staffing services and solutions in the United States. It operates through two segments, Technology, and Finance and Accounting (FA). The Technology segment provides talent solutions to its clients primarily in the areas of information technology, such as systems/applications architecture and development, data management and analytics, business and artificial intelligence, machine learning, project and program management, and network architecture and security.
